Typical Issues with Bi-Fold Doors
Bi-fold doors are made up of numerous panels that fold together when opened or closed. They are normally mounted on a track system that allows them to move smoothly. Nevertheless, gradually, the doors can end up being misaligned, the tracks can end up being clogged, and the hinges can use out. Here are some common issues that can accompany bi-fold doors:
Misaligned doorsSticky or jammed doorsUsed out hinges or rollersBroken or harmed panelsFaulty locking mechanisms

1. Repairing Misaligned Doors
Misaligned doors can be triggered by loose hinges, unequal tracks, or deformed panels. Here's how to fix them:

Sticky or jammed doors can be caused by broken rollers, misaligned tracks, or extreme dust buildup. Here's how to fix them:

Worn out hinges or rollers can trigger the doors to end up being misaligned or sticky. Here's how to replace them:

Preventative Maintenance for Bi-Fold Doors
To avoid typical problems with bi-fold doors, it's necessary to carry out routine maintenance tasks. Here are some ideas:
Clean the tracks and rollers frequently to avoid dust buildup.Oil the hinges and rollers to make sure smooth operation.Inspect the positioning of the doors and adjust them if necessary.Inspect the locking mechanism and replace any broken parts.
